Rib Cage Tattoos - Script Tattoos and Other Designs That Look Great For Men and Women

Being tattooed on one’s rib cage is considered to be one of the most painful spots in the body to get ink. Due to everybody’s unique body shape, natural curves, and size, rib cage tattoos prove challenging for tattoo artists as well. Before you decide to finally get a tattoo in this very sensitive part, be sure to go through all facts and consider all the key issues first.

Angel Tattoos - What Does Yours Mean to You?

Angel tattoos or some other kind of ink? That’s what you’ve been thinking about; probably keeping your eyes open for months for the perfect, unique image. Maybe you think if you see another tribal or dragon tat, your eyeballs will fall out. That isn’t what you want! You want something that will have lasting meaning to you personally, as well as being a beautiful work of art that you can wear with pride every day. An angel tattoo is a clear symbol of one’s belief in higher powers, and the choice to align yourself with the positive energy of creation. Another way of interpreting the angel tattoo seems to be to take just the wings and put them with something else that has meaning to you, for example a heart or other symbol.

Tattoo Crosses - 3 Types of Crosses Commonly Used in Tattoos

One of the most renowned tattoos would have to be the cross, there are so many different meanings associated with the cross they simply cannot all be explained at once. The most obvious association with crosses is religion, mainly Christian and Catholic symbolism.
